Here's a time lapse I made of the Delaware River near Philadelphia.  At this location the Delaware is tidal and the water surface elevation changes throughout the day.  Lots of legacy submerged man-made structure here revealed at low tide.  The silver cylinder near the middle is a staff gauge with 1-foot markings for reference.
